Flying from Columbia Metropolitan Airport (CAE) to Philadelphia: what you need to know
The average time for a direct flight from Columbia Metropolitan Airport to Philadelphia is 2 hours.
Philadelphia's timezone is UTC-4, which is the same as Columbia (the location of Columbia Metropolitan Airport).
Columbia Metropolitan Airport (CAE) to Philadelphia International Airport (PHL) is the most popular route, with 13 weekly flights to choose from. If you prefer starting your day later, the last flight from CAE to PHL is with American Airlines at 18:26. Choose the first departure operated by American Airlines at 07:20 if you want to fly out earlier.
For stress-free travel, arrive at the airport two hours ahead of international flights and one hour before domestic departures. This ensures you have enough time to board your CAE to Philadelphia flight.
Delays at check-in and security are more likely if you're flying during high season, so allow some extra breathing space. A good rule of thumb for peak periods? Arrive up to four hours ahead for international flights and two hours for domestic departures.

Airports in Philadelphia
Philadelphia International Airport (PHL)
The distance from Philadelphia International Airport (PHL) to central Philadelphia is roughly 19 kilometres. It'll take you about 15 minutes to get to the centre driving.
Travelling to the centre by public transport takes about 45 minutes.

Best time to go to Philadelphia
Before locking in your flights from Columbia Metropolitan Airport to Philadelphia, consider which time of year is best for you. High season in Philadelphia offers a lively atmosphere and plenty of things to do, while the low season means you'll get cheaper hotel deals and smaller crowds.
Book a Columbia Metropolitan Airport to Philadelphia flight ticket with a departure in July if you're eager to visit the city during its warmest month. Expect temperatures to range from 18ºC to 32ºC.
Look for cheap tickets from CAE to Philadelphia in January if you like travelling in cooler conditions. Temperatures are at their lowest then, ranging between -7ºC and 9ºC on average.
